Shelley Niro

Shelley Niro (born 1954) is a Mohawk filmmaker and visual artist from New York and Ontario.〔("Native Networks: Shelley Niro." ) ''Smithsonian National Museum of the American Indian''. (retrieved 2 Dec 2010)〕
==Background==
Shelley Niro was born in Niagara Falls, New York in 1954 and grew up on the Six Nations Reserve, near Brantford, Ontario, Canada. She is a member of the Turtle Clan. Niro graduated from the Ontario College of Art with a bachelor of fine arts degree in sculpture and painting. She earned her masters of fine arts degree from the University of Western Ontario.〔
